Joint Prakas No. 363 (MAFF MOH) on management of production, import, export and trade of veterinary drugs.

Abstract
The purpose of this Joint Regulation (Joint Prakas) is to manage and control the production, import, export and trade of veterinary drugs in order to eliminate illegal business operations of veterinary drugs, ensuring their quality and protecting the interests of consumers, producers and traders.
The Joint Regulation consists of 11 Chapters divided into 53 articles: General provisions (1); Formalities and Conditions in opening establishments for the production of veterinary drugs (2); Formalities and Conditions in opening, closing or changing establishments of import-export of veterinary drugs (3); Formalities and Conditions in opening, closing or changing establishments of sale of veterinary drugs (4); Formalities and Conditions of registration of visa or register of veterinary drugs (5); Import-export of veterinary drugs (6); Advertisement of veterinary drugs (7); Obligation of business persons (8); Competence of management (9); Penal provisions (10); and Final provisions (11).
Any person who intends to carry out business in relation to production, import, export, distribution or sale of veterinary drugs shall be required to have a permit for business operation, visa or registration of business, and an authorization for import from the Ministry of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ries. The Ministry shall manage, inspect and instruct the business operations of veterinary drugs of all types in the Kingdom of Cambodia.
